Responsibilities

  • Adheres to Standard Operating Procedures, cGMPs, Quality Manual, and company policies.
  • Performs routine extractions for dissolution, assay, and impurities testing.
  • Performs routine testing using analytical equipment including but not limited to KFC, dissolution apparatus, water activity, FTIR, etc.
  • Conducts appearance testing, raw materials sampling, solution preparation, and pH measurements.
  • Drafts stability tables, sets-up stability studies, logs-in samples and standards.
  • Cleans lab and glassware and disposes of analytical waste appropriately.
